Coffee Talk Name that player!
Bears' most explosive receiver, with 18.3-yard career average per catch. Had four touchdown catches in 1988, including scoring plays of 63 yards (Buffalo), 39 (Dallas), and 31 (Detroit). Only Bears rookie to earn starting job in 1987, starting all 12 non-strike games and catching 42-yard touchdown pass against defending Super Bowl-champion Giants. Led team in receiving all four years at SMU and finished career as third-leading receiver in school's history with 147 catches and 14 touchdowns. First-team All-Southwest Conference as senior. Won Texas 100- and 200-meter championships in high school.
